Product Description

  • Martin Guitar D-200 Deluxe
  • Acoustic Guitar
  • Set of Martin D-200 guitar and a high-quality RGM D200 watch
  • Designed in collaboration with watchmaker Roland G. Murphy (RGM)
  • Limited to 50 pieces worldwide
  • Number 20 of 50
  • Construction: Dreadnought
  • Top: solid Engelmann spruce
  • Back and sides: Rio rosewood
  • Neck: Mahogany
  • Headstock: Rio rosewood
  • Fingerboard: Ebony
  • Shells and wood Custom Watch Theme Design fingerboard inlays
  • Rosette with custom inlay
  • Scale: 645 mm (25.4")
  • Nut width: 44.5 mm (1.75")
  • Bone nut
  • 20 Frets
  • Ebony bridge with compensated bone saddle
  • Open nickel tuners
  • Serial number: 2000020
  • Factory strings: MTCN160 Titanium Core Light .012 - .055 (art. #511870#)
  • Colour: Natural
  • Incl. RGM D200 watch and aluminium hard case
  • Made in USA
